Manager of the Griffith Sports College, Griffith University

Duncan understands the challenges that arise for athletes who are competing at the highest level, whilst also studying at university.

Whilst completing his Bachelor of Health Science with Griffith University, Duncan competed in four Olympic Games. He won an Olympic Bronze Medal at the 1996 Atlanta Olympics and in 2008, at his 4th Olympics, he won a Gold Medal.

Duncan is strongly committed to supporting athletes, and he took part in the 2012 London Olympics as a mentor. Now he is able to follow his passion as a sports mentor at Griffith University, where he is committed to supporting young athletes like you, achieve your sporting and educational goals.
